IPG DXTRA, INC. was awarded a contract with the United States Government for $0.00. The contract was awarded by the agency office CDC OFFICE OF ACQUISITION SERVICES, which is a division with the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ention within the Department of Health and Human Services.

Summary of Award

The awarded contract between the US federal government and the recipient, IPG DXTRA, INC., is for health marketing services under a Blanket Purchase Agreement (BPA). The contract was signed on September 25, 2015, with a total obligation of $0. The contract falls under the Department of Health and Human Services, specifically the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ention.

IPG DXTRA, INC. is a U.S.-owned business based in New York, offering professional communication services. The company has been awarded multiple modifications to the contract, with the latest transaction recorded on March 31, 2025. The contract has a performance period starting from September 29, 2015, to September 28, 2025.

The contract transactions show that there have been multiple modifications (Mods) to the contract over the years, with the most recent being Mod 8 on March 31, 2025. Each modification has resulted in a transaction amount of $0, indicating that the contract terms have been adjusted without any additional financial obligations. The contract is categorized under the Product or Service Code R426, which corresponds to "Support- Professional: Communications" and the NAICS code 541613 for "Marketing Consulting Services." The contract pricing is firm-fixed price, and the contract type is a Multiple Award BPA.
